      <description>&lt;P&gt;I've just transferred from Plusnet to EE. The Wifi connection from the new Smarthub SH31B keeps dropping off and most of the time can't connect using WPS. (the password method is ridiculous as it's 16 characters). The Plusnet Hub one had no problems connecting to the TV and never dropped off. Can anyone tell me the difference between these hubs and is their a solution?&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;PN: WiFi5, WPA2 vs. EE SH6+: WiFi6, WPA3.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Sometimes older or weaker devices may not be compatible with the default WiFi settings of EE Smart Hubs. Try setting up Compatible WiFi on the router under Advanced &amp;gt; Wireless Settings &amp;gt; Config &amp;gt; Compatible WiFi (it defaults to 2.4 GHz only &amp;amp; WPA2) &amp;amp; connect your problematic 2.4 GHz devices to that.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
